无法使用创建图形jp@gc-Jmeter中的图形生成器

无法使用创建图形jp@gc-Jmeter中的图形生成器,jmeter,performance-testing,jmeter-plugins,Jmeter,Performance Testing,Jmeter Plugins,我想用jp@gc-我的测试计划中的图形生成器,用于从现有结果文件(results.csv)创建图形 我收到错误-加载文件时出错。 My results.csv文件包含如下数据: 14:31:14;1208;登录;200;好啊螺纹组1-2;文本;是的;950;10;10;1208;1.0;U6021712-TPL-A 我不确定Graphs Generator如何使用上述数据创建各种图形。在检查错误日志时,我注意到以下消息: 2014/12/12 14:31:29 INFO - jmeter.sa

我想用jp@gc-我的测试计划中的图形生成器,用于从现有结果文件(results.csv)创建图形

我收到错误-加载文件时出错。

My results.csv文件包含如下数据:

14:31:14;1208;登录;200;好啊螺纹组1-2;文本;是的;950;10;10;1208;1.0;U6021712-TPL-A

我不确定Graphs Generator如何使用上述数据创建各种图形。在检查错误日志时,我注意到以下消息:

2014/12/12 14:31:29 INFO  - jmeter.save.CSVSaveService: results.csv does not appear to have a valid header. Using default configuration.

2014/12/12 14:31:29 WARN  - jmeter.save.CSVSaveService: Error parsing field 'timeStamp' at line 1 java.text.ParseException: Unparseable date: ""

2014/12/12 14:31:29 WARN  - jmeter.reporters.ResultCollector: Problem reading JTL file: results.csv

任何帮助都将不胜感激

正如错误消息所说,在运行此代码的JMeter实例上,timestamp字段的定义中有一个错误。 并且配置与生成CSV文件的配置不同

因此,您需要检查此实例上使用的jmeter.properties和user.properties与生成CSV的实例上使用的jmeter.properties和user.properties是否相同

例如,在这里,您应该使用此选项来解决此问题(但您可能有其他问题):

  • jmeter.save.saveservice.timestamp_format=HH:mm:ss

在Jmeter中,时间戳是长数据类型。所以请确保时间戳行中没有空格(如果您有空格,jmeter不会接受它并抛出

java.lang.NumberFormatException: For input string: "timeStamp"
例如:

有效数据集

1456177238234,224,Java Request 1,200,,Auto Quick Invest 1-1,,true,,0,2,2,null,0,1,0,M-SFO1-SFO1216
 1456177238234,224,Java Request 1,200,,Auto Quick Invest 1-1,,true,,0,2,2,null,0,1,0,M-SFO1-SFO1216
无效数据集

1456177238234,224,Java Request 1,200,,Auto Quick Invest 1-1,,true,,0,2,2,null,0,1,0,M-SFO1-SFO1216
 1456177238234,224,Java Request 1,200,,Auto Quick Invest 1-1,,true,,0,2,2,null,0,1,0,M-SFO1-SFO1216
因为时间戳字段有空间